Bradley Giglio is an experienced trial attorney with more than ten years of trial experience. Bradley spends time with his clients, carefully understanding what they need and what they are seeking, and brings all of his experience to bear in fighting on their behalf. Bradley’s success speaks for itself in the many examples of how he has helped his clients obtain positive outcomes in difficult situations.

Bradley successfully tried an Order of Protection case for his client whose ex-husband was using the children as a means to harass her while avoiding prosecution by the State’s Attorney. After the Order of Protection was entered against the ex-husband, he appealed the case to try and get it thrown out. Bradley stood by his client and had the experience and ability to continue fighting in the Appellate Court. Bradley defended the appeal and was successful in keeping the Order of Protection for his client. When the Order of Protection was due to expire, Bradley traveled to a separate county and once again went to a hearing for his client and obtained an extension of the Order of Protection. It was then that Bradley’s goal was realized in the peace that his client gained through the Order of Protection.

Bradley successfully defended a client who was being deported in Immigration Court for having committed a criminal offense. Bradley carefully reviewed the client’s case and filed documents to Cancel the Removal Proceeding. After compiling an extensive hardship packet and presenting the documentation to the Court, the removal proceeding was stopped and the client’s Permanent Resident status was reinstated. The client is now able to remain in the United States with his two children.

Bradley has successfully defended clients charged with criminal offenses in Federal and State Court charged with Felonies and Misdemeanors including charges of Delivery of a Controlled Substance, Domestic Battery, Leaving the Scene of an Accident, Possession with intent to Deliver, Aggravated Battery, Robbery, DUI, traffic, among other offenses.

Bradley also successfully assisted a client who came to Bradley when his Asylum case was being denied after having been in this country for 25 years. Bradley identified another avenue for the client to remain in the United States, filed for NICARA relief, obtained Permanent Resident status for his client, and his client has been allowed to remain in the United States with his family.
At the Mevorah Law Offices, Bradley focuses on litigation, bringing his criminal and civil trial experience in DuPage, Cook, Will and Champaign Counties. He is a rising star, asked to manage this twelve-attorney law firm because of his courtroom and management experience as well as his client-centered approach to his practice.

Bradley is a born litigator and is a “go-getter,” having tried several jury trials before even graduating law school. He enhanced his trial ability as a prosecutor with the Cook County State’s Attorney for seven years and as an associate with the Mevorah Law Offices.

In the Cook County State’s Attorney’s office Bradley handled criminal appeals including arguing several cases before the First District Court of Appeals, serving in the Felony Trial Division, and serving in a specialized unit handling sex offenses committed by offenders in a position of authority such as priests or police officers and cases where the offender sexually assaulted more than one victim.

Bradley underwent negotiation training at the FBI Academy at Quantico, Virginia, and interned with the U.S. Army JAG Corps where he assisted in the defense of a Sergeant being Court Martialed. He has also been trained in computer and internet crimes, specifically in search and recovery and forensic investigations at the Regional Computer Forensic Laboratory (RCFL) in Chicago. Bradley has also received training at the National Center for Missing and Exploited Children related to online crimes against children.

Brad’s commitment and attention to his clients comes from his advocacy work for the Office of Women’s Programs at the University of Illinois as a Campus Acquaintance Rape Educator and Instructor. His ability to connect with clients and address their needs earned him Client Counseling Champion at the University of Illinois College of Law.

Brad has also dedicated his time to the free legal clinic at the University of Illinois-College of Law where he handled divorces for women victimized by domestic violence and obtained social security/disability benefits for a severely disabled person. Bradley prepares each of his cases for trial and is ready to go to trial to fully represent his client’s interests.
